




Offices starting from £6868
POA
Offices starting from £530
Offices starting from £230
Offices starting from £500
Offices starting from £633
POA
POA
POA
Offices starting from £43000
POA
Offices starting from £692
POA
Offices starting from £732
POA
POA
Offices starting from £799
POA
Offices starting from £425
Offices starting from £249
Offices starting from £2000
POA
Offices starting from £350
POA
Items per page